General Description
The Fairchild FM3570 replaces the CPU motherboard’s configuration switches with an electronic implementation consisting of a 4/5-bit multiplexed, 1-bit latched port, standard 2-wire bus interface, and non-volatile latches. The FM3570 multiplexes the I-port input signals with two internal non-volatile registers that can be loaded through the serial port. The multiplexer is selected via the serial port and defaults to the I-port upon power-up. Pull-up resistors are provided on the input port to accommodate connections to open-drain outputs and to eliminate the need for external resistors. The device has opendrain outputs for easy interface to devices with different VDD levels. The serial port is an IIC compatible slave-only interface and supports both 100kbit and 400kbit modes of operation. The port is used to read the I-Port, write data to the internal non-volatile registers and select whether the I-port or one of the internal nonvolatile registers is output to the Y-port. The FM3570 is fabricated with advanced CMOS technology to achieve high density and low power operation.
